What is Remote Key Programming?

Remote key programming is the process of syncing an automobile's Engine Control Unit (ECU) or Immobilizer system with a specific remote or transponder key. Every contemporary vehicle utilizes an unique digital signature to make sure that just the authorized key can unlock the doors and begin the engine.

When a button is continued a key fob, it sends a radio frequency (RF) signal to the car. If the signal matches the code kept in the automobile's computer system, the command is performed. Without correct programming, a new key-- even if it is the correct physical shape-- will be unable to communicate with the automobile, rendering it useless for most contemporary security functions.

The Science of Security: Rolling Codes

To avoid car theft through "signal grabbing," most manufacturers utilize "rolling codes." This implies that every time the remote is utilized, both the key and the car generate a brand-new digital code for the next use. If the sequences fall out of sync, the key might require reprogramming.


Types of Modern Car Keys

Before trying to configure a key, it is vital to understand which type of innovation the automobile uses. Various secrets need various programming strategies.

  1. Transponder Keys: These look like basic secrets however have a concealed chip in the plastic head. The car won't start unless it detects the chip.
  2. Remote Keyless Entry (RKE) Fobs: These are utilized mainly for locking/unlocking doors and trunk release.
  3. Integrated Key/Remote: A single system where the physical key blade is connected to the remote buttons.
  4. Smart Keys/ Proximity Fobs: These enable the driver to keep the type in their pocket. The car identifies the fob's existence to unlock doors and enable the push-to-start ignition.

Techniques of Programming a Remote Key

There are three main methods to deal with remote key programming. The method needed depends greatly on the make, design, and year of the automobile.

1. On-Board Programming (DIY)

Some older lorries or particular makers (such as numerous Ford, Toyota, and GM models from the early 2000s) permit owners to program secrets themselves. This normally involves a "series of actions," such as turning the ignition on and off a particular number of times or opening and closing the driver-side door in a particular pattern.

2. OBD-II Port Programming

A lot of automobiles manufactured after 2010 require a connection to the On-Board Diagnostics (OBD-II) port. Professional locksmith professionals and car dealerships use specialized diagnostic tablets to "introduce" the new key's ID to the lorry's computer system. This is a highly safe approach that often requires a web connection to the maker's database.

3. Key Cloning

Particular locksmith professionals use a cloning device. Instead of programming the car to acknowledge a brand-new key, they set a blank key to simulate the digital signature of the existing, working key. This is often faster but may not work for all high-security "smart" systems.

The Programming Process: A General Overview

While every car is various, the expert programming procedure usually follows these actions:

  1. Preparation: The service technician makes sure the battery in the brand-new remote is fresh and the automobile battery is fully charged.
  2. Connection: A diagnostic tool is plugged into the OBD-II port (generally located under the dashboard).
  3. Authentication: The specialist enters the automobile's VIN and often a specific "Pin Code" supplied by the maker.
  4. Deletion: If keys have been lost or taken, the technician might erase old key IDs from the system to guarantee the lost keys can no longer begin the car.
  5. Syncing: The new key is positioned in a particular "hotspot" (typically the center console or against the steering column), and the software synchronizes the brand-new ID.
  6. Testing: Every button (Lock, Unlock, Trunk, Panic) is evaluated, in addition to the engine start functionality.

Common Reasons for Programming Failure

  • Dead Batteries: Even a new key from an online seller may have a dead or weak battery.
  • Incorrect Frequency: Key remotes run on specific MHz frequencies. If a remote was bought online and is for the European market (315MHz vs. 433MHz), it will not deal with an US vehicle.
  • Harmed Transponder Chip: If the key is dropped or exposed to water, the internal chip can break or short-circuit.
  • Optimum Key Limit: Many automobiles have a limit on how numerous keys can be programmed (normally 4 to 8). If the limit is reached, old secrets need to be deleted before brand-new ones can be added.
  • Aftermarket Quality Issues: Cheap, unbranded secrets from third-party sites typically have "locking" chips that can just be programmed as soon as. If they were previously synced to another car, they can not be recycled.

Checklist: Items Needed for Key Programming

If a car owner plans to have actually a key configured, they must have the following products ready to ensure a smooth process:

  • The car's Vehicle Identification Number (VIN).
  • All existing working keys (programming a new key often wipes the old ones if they aren't present).
  • Evidence of ownership (Title or Registration) and a valid ID.
  • The key code (often found on a little metal tag provided when the car was new).
  • A fully charged car battery (voltage drops during programming can "brick" the car's computer system).

Often Asked Questions (FAQ)

1. Can I program a car key myself?

It depends on the vehicle. Many older automobiles (pre-2010) permit manual programming series. Nevertheless, most modern-day cars need specific software application that only locksmith professionals or dealers possess.

2. Can I purchase an utilized key fob from eBay and program it?

This is dangerous. Lots of modern-day fobs are "locked" once they are configured to a particular VIN. Unless the seller ensures the chip has actually been "opened" or "revitalized," it may be impossible to program it to a 2nd car.

3. How long does the programming process take?

Usually, the actual programming takes in between 15 and 30 minutes. However, cutting a physical emergency blade and establishing the diagnostic software application might extend the visit to an hour.

4. Why is the dealer a lot more expensive than a locksmith?

Dealers have higher overhead and typically utilize expensive, manufacturer-original parts. Locksmiths often use high-quality aftermarket parts and have lower operating expense, permitting them to charge less for the exact same service.

5. What should I do if my remote works for the doors but will not begin the car?

This normally indicates that the RKE (Remote Keyless Entry) part is programmed, however the transponder chip or the immobilizer sync has actually failed. This requires an expert diagnostic tool to repair.
